Title :
Transient analysis of Jang-Bin wind farm connected to Taipower grid

Abstract :
This paper presents the transient simulated results of a three-phase short-circuit fault applied to one of the feeders of Jang-Bin wind farm connected to Taipower grid using a commercial power-system simulation software of PSS/E. The simulated transient voltage fluctuations, power variations, and frequency changes can serve as an operation reference for a power system connected with large-scale wind farms. It can also serve as a reference for the future development of Taiwan´s offshore wind farms.
